For the record, ThomB is running an Ubuntu Gutsy dash .deb that I provided him. It has the same cmdtxt bug fix as Debian 0.5.4-8, and is built with DEB_BUILD_OPTIONS=nostrip, hence the halfway-useful stack trace.
For a start, that trace makes it clear that it is not a duplicate of #467065. By analogy, bugs 462414, 462977, 463649, 468376, 468449, 468837, and 469102 are all duplicates of this one, not 467065. 467358 is less clear, since it's architecture (amd64) doesn't match the others, so the stack trace is not provably equivalent. Other than suggesting that users hit by this bug install libc6-dbg, I don't know where to go from here.
